Definitions

  1. n. The act of sending or throwing out; the act of sending forth or putting into circulation; issue; as, the emission of light from the sun; the emission of heat from a fire; the emission of bank notes.
  2. n. That which is sent out, issued, or put in circulation at one time; issue; as, the emission was mostly blood.
  3. n. the act of emitting; causing to flow forth
  4. n. a substance that is emitted or released
  5. n. the release of electrons from parent atoms
  6. n. any of several bodily processes by which substances go out of the body
  7. n. the occurrence of a flow of water (as from a pipe)

Emission theory (Physics), the theory of Newton, regarding light as consisting of emitted particles or corpuscles. See Corpuscular theory, under Corpuscular.
